I've just got a Nissin Di622 for the wife. I gave her my 550D a while back when I upgraded but wanted to keep my Di866 as its such a good flash. The one I brought was £95 from a reliable ebay seller and for the price it's an amazingly powerful flash. Can be used as an off camera wireless flash with the right body as well which is always a bonus. Overall I say it's great, well built, fast recharge and very powerful.
